What Does a Solar Inverter Actually Do?

 

A solar inverter converts the direct current (DC) electricity generated by solar panels into alternating current (AC) electricity that powers homes and businesses.

 

Without an inverter, solar panels cannot provide usable electricity for most appliances and equipment.

 

 

Today's advanced solar inverter systems can also provide:

  • Real time energy monitoring
  • Battery charging management
  • Backup power support
  • Grid interaction
  • Smart energy optimization

 

As solar technology evolves, the inverter has become the control center of modern solar energy systems.

 

How Long Do Solar Inverters Typically Last?

 

The lifespan of a solar inverter depends on several factors, including technology type, operating environment, installation quality, and maintenance practices.

 

String Inverters

Traditional string inverters generally last:

  • 10 to 15 years:These are commonly used in residential solar systems and usually require replacement before the solar panels reach the end of their lifespan.

 

Hybrid Solar Inverters

Modern hybrid solar inverters typically last:

  • 10 to 20 years:Because they include advanced cooling systems, intelligent energy management, and battery integration functions, hybrid inverters often achieve longer service life.

     

 

Microinverters

Microinverters can last:

  • 20 to 25 years:Since each solar panel operates independently, system reliability is often improved and maintenance requirements may be reduced.

Why Do Some Solar Inverters Fail Earlier Than Others?

Not all solar inverters age at the same rate.Several factors can significantly impact inverter longevity.

 

Heat and Ventilation

Excessive heat is one of the primary causes of inverter failure.Poor airflow can accelerate the aging of electronic components such as capacitors and power modules.Installing the inverter in a shaded and well ventilated location can improve long term reliability.

 

Environmental Conditions

Dust, humidity, salt exposure, and harsh weather conditions can increase wear on inverter components.Choosing an inverter with a high protection rating such as IP65 is especially important for outdoor installations.

 

Electrical Stress

Voltage fluctuations, grid instability, and improper system sizing can place additional strain on inverter electronics.Professional system design helps ensure optimal performance and extended lifespan.

 

How Can You Extend the Life of Your Solar Inverter?

Fortunately, several best practices can help maximize inverter lifespan.

 

Invest in High Quality Equipment

Premium solar inverter systems often feature superior cooling designs, advanced electronics, and higher quality components.Although the initial investment may be higher, long term reliability is typically better.

 

Perform Routine Maintenance

Regular maintenance can help identify potential issues early.

 

Recommended maintenance includes:

  • Cleaning ventilation areas
  • Inspecting electrical connections
  • Monitoring performance data
  • Checking for warning messages

 

Proper System Design

Correct inverter sizing reduces operational stress and improves efficiency.

 

Working with experienced solar professionals helps ensure the system is designed for long term success.

When Should You Replace a Solar Inverter?

Even the best inverter will eventually reach the end of its useful life.

 

Common warning signs include:

  • Frequent error alarms
  • Reduced solar production
  • Communication failures
  • Unexpected shutdowns
  • Excessive overheating

 

If your inverter is over 10 years old and showing these symptoms, replacement may be more economical than repeated repairs.

Why Are Hybrid Inverters Becoming the Industry Standard?

The growth of battery storage is transforming the solar industry.

 

A modern solar battery storage system allows users to store excess solar energy generated during the day and use it when electricity demand is highest.

 

Hybrid inverters make this possible by managing:

  • Solar generation
  • Battery charging and discharging
  • Utility grid interaction
  • Backup power operation

 

As electricity costs continue to increase globally, more homeowners and businesses are adopting hybrid inverter systems to improve energy independence and reduce utility bills.
